📊 Ethereum Mainnet Parameters
Network Name
Ethereum Mainnet
Pre-configured in most wallets (e.g., MetaMask)
RPC URL
https://ethereum.publicnode.com
Public / Infura / Alchemy
Chain ID
1
The Genesis ID (Original)
Gas Token
ETH
High Gas fees
Block Time
≈ 12 Seconds
Stable block generation (Post-PoS Merge)
Rec. Nodes
Alchemy / Chainstack / Infura / QuickNode
Private nodes offer lower latency; public nodes are prone to congestion.
Primary DEX
Uniswap V2/V3
Largest Decentralized Exchange

⛽️ ETH Gas Fees & Optimization (Important)
Current Average Gas: 15 - 50 Gwei (Highly Volatile).
Cost-Saving Tips (Must Read):
Avoid Congestion: Monitor the Etherscan Gas Tracker. Transact during weekends or late night (UTC) for lower fees.
Set Limits: Manually adjust the Max Fee cap in your wallet's (e.g., MetaMask) advanced settings.
Batch Operations: Use SlerfTools Batch Transfer to bundle transactions instead of sending them one by one.
Dry Run on L2: Test your workflow on Layer 2 chains (Base/Arbitrum) first before executing on the expensive ETH Mainnet.
📊 Essential Developer Resources
Below are the core contract addresses on the Ethereum Mainnet. Always verify the address before interacting:
WETH (Wrapped Ether)
0xC02aaA39b223FE8D0A0e5C4F27eAD9083C756Cc2
USDT (ERC20)
0xdAC17F958D2ee523a2206206994597C13D831ec7
USDC (ERC20)
0xA0b86991c6218b36c1d19D4a2e9Eb0cE3606eB48
Uniswap V2 Router
0x7a250d5630B4cF539739dF2C5dAcb4c659F2488D
